Pilgrim’s Rest is one of the first true safe havens you’ll come across in Silksong. Nestled within the Far Fields, it offers Hornet a chance to sit at a Bench, meet NPCs, and access useful tools. But reaching it isn’t enough—you’ll also need to unlock its door before you can rest inside. This guide explains how to get there, what you’ll need, and the steps to open Pilgrim’s Rest.

How to Find Pilgrim’s Rest Location
Before unlocking the door, you’ll first need to progress through the Far Fields, one of the sprawling biomes east of Bone Bottom.
- Enter Far Fields – After the battle with Lace, take the right-side tunnel to enter the region. You’ll encounter Plant Beasts and Ant Warriors along the way.
- Activate Checkpoints – Spend Rosary Beads to unlock the Bench and Bellway in Far Fields. These fast-travel points will make your journey easier.
- Find Shakra for the Map – Speak with Shakra, the cartographer, to purchase the Far Fields map. This makes navigation much simpler.
- Climb the Vertical Shaft – Work your way up through wind vents, ledges, and enemy encounters until you reach the upper section that leads directly into Pilgrim’s Rest.

How to Open the Pilgrim’s Rest Door
When you first arrive, you’ll find two Pilgrims outside—the Broken Pilgrim and the Weary Pilgrim. The building itself is locked, and the only way in is by spending Rosary Beads.
- Cost to Unlock: 30 Rosary Beads
- What You Gain:
- A Bench inside to save and heal.
- Access to Mort, a trader NPC who sells Tools and upgrades.
- A permanent safe zone within the Far Fields for future exploration.
Once you pay the cost, the door opens permanently, allowing Hornet to return here anytime.
NPCs at Pilgrim’s Rest in Silksong
Pilgrim’s Rest isn’t just a resting point—it’s also home to a couple of important characters:
- Weary Pilgrim – An NPC outside the door, reflecting on the hardships of travel.
- Mort – Found inside, Mort offers a selection of Tools. His wares are expensive, so it’s best to save Rosary Beads before spending.

Quick Tips Before Attempting
- Stock Up on Rosary Beads: At least 80–100 before entering Far Fields—30 for the door, and extra for the Bench and Bellway.
- Clear Enemies Carefully: Slasher Bees and Ant Warriors in the vertical shaft can overwhelm if rushed.
- Buy the Map: Navigating without Shakra’s map makes finding Pilgrim’s Rest much harder.
